While there are modern iterations of the JSA in the comics, it’s better if a Justice Society movie follows the team’s exploits during World War II.
Think of it being analogous to when the JSA lived on a different Earth during the Silver Age and the New 52.
Since there’s no indication that there was a team of superheroes operating during the 1940s in the DC Extended Universe, a Justice Society movie would be best suited for this new DC films banner so as not to worry about continuity.
Captain America: The First Avenger and Wonder Woman proved how entertaining period piece superhero movies can be, and much of the JSA’s appeal stems from the legacy they left when battling the Axis powers.
